Hello, my name is Kaijian Zou. My Chinese name is 邹凯键. People usually call me Kai.

I am a 3rd-year Ph.D. Candidate at the University of Michigan, advised by Prof. Lu Wang and a member of the LAUNCH Group.

I earned my B.S. in Computer Science from Cornell University, where I had the privilege of working with Prof. Claire Cardie on summarization research.

My research interests lie in Natural Language Processing, Deep Learning, and Machine Learning. Currently, I am focusing on the safety of large language model (LLM) agents and the evaluation of long-context language models.
